HB 22-1134

signed

Measures To Reduce Use Single-use Meal Accessories

Plain-English Summary

AI-generated

House Bill 22-1134, which has been signed into law in Colorado, requires restaurants and food delivery services to only provide single-use items like utensils or condiments if the customer specifically asks for them. This means that starting from January 1, 2023, businesses can't automatically include these items with takeout orders or deliveries unless requested by the customer. The law aims to reduce waste by encouraging customers to request single-use items only when necessary. It affects all retail food establishments and third-party delivery services in Colorado.

Official Summary

The bill specifies that, commencing January 1, 2023, a retail food establishment or third-party food delivery service (service) may provide a customer with single-use food serviceware or a single-use condiment that accompanies food ordered for delivery or carryout only if the customer requests single-use food serviceware or a single-use condiment or confirms that the customer wants single-use food serviceware or a single-use condiment when offered, with limited exceptions.(Note: This summary applies to this bill as introduced.)
